    m52 swap

    Hey whats up kidz. My car is an alpine white 1984 325e..the good ol eta m20. Approximately 2 months ago a good deal came around for an m52 engine off of a 1997 528i (m52 2.8L). I immediately got hold of the engine and decided to do the swap. A couple of weeks later i started buying certain parts i would need (e.g., oil pan, engine mounts, new intake, manual transmission,new cluster, etc..). Working along side with my father we did the fitting of the engine and everything else in approximately 4 days. As of this moment everything is IN, just ONE more step: getting all the OBDII components--yeah, im staying OBDII. In the future though, ill be upgrading certain components, like the intake and such, to get those power increase.

    so check it out, these are pics of some of the stuff i've added. Ill be taking pics of everything inside once i finish up the OBDII stuff.
